While driving, he jerked and slurred. Eventually it went out. Fluids normal, the starter spins like crazy, and it refuses to snort. The day before yesterday it was flooded with 30 liters, since then it has been driven over a hundred. The relays can be heard clicking when the ignition is turned on.
There are two errors under the mine:
00522 engine coolant temperature sensor g62
30-10 open or short to plus - intermittent
00550 - start of injection regulation
17-10 control difference - intermittent
The first thing I unplugged the G62 plug, but it did not want to fire after all.
It is true that on the summer engine I checked the injection start angle in the BS in the vagcom and it was about 81 (and 49-51 for the afn correctly), I tried to change but it was reluctant, overall I jump between 59-80.
After this treatment, the car fires after a few seconds of spinning, but it works at 2-3 grams. Errors are not thrown out. Also, the car does not work on all cylinders on the so-called "cake".
n108 ticks during the output test, so it looks like it's ok.
